What happens when the trends disappear?Tim Dekens, founder of The Change Starts, shares how his brand went from riding the peak of the plant-based wave to rebuilding its identity beyond labels. In the early days, bold content featuring elite plant-based athletes gave the brand rapid traction. But when public interest shifted, the message no longer landed.That’s when the real work began. Tim explains how they reframed the brand’s purpose, focused on performance and small shifts, and built trust with athletes (plant-based or not).It’s a story about letting go of hype to find a more honest and lasting impact.In just 8 minutes, we explore what founders can learn when trends lose their power.Listen to the whole conversation with Tim here
